An enormous thing about this recipe would be that the bread is sour dough, it provides it a lot flavor. Also, Red Lobster used langostino, crab, and petite shrimp. With this particular dish it's the small things which make the large difference. Additionally they don't prepare the cheese and also the sea food together. The sea food is put into the bowl and also the cheese is added on the top and given a fast stir. Try a few of these changes and you will possess a different outcome. (I labored at Red Lobster for more than a year)
